ANI Pharmaceuticals reported Q1 2026 earnings per share (EPS) of $2.05, handily surpassing the consensus estimate of $1.3308 by 54.04%. Revenue figures were not disclosed in the reported data. Despite the significant earnings beat, the stock declined by 0.27% following the announcement, suggesting potential profit‑taking or broader market headwinds.

The dramatic bottom‑line outperformance signals strong operational execution, likely driven by robust sales in the company’s generic and branded pharmaceutical portfolios. While no segment‑level revenue details were provided, the EPS surge implies effective cost control and favorable product mix shifts. Operating margins may have expanded as higher‑margin products gained traction, aided by manufacturing efficiencies and disciplined expense management. The company’s continued focus on its specialty generic pipeline and strategic acquisitions (such as the recent purchase of certain generic assets) appears to be paying off. Additionally, the quarter likely benefited from contributions from key products in the areas of central nervous system, anti‑infectives, and other therapeutic categories. The management team has emphasized its ability to leverage its enhanced commercial infrastructure to capture market share. With the EPS beat being so substantial, investors will be keen to understand whether one‑time items or sustainable operational improvements drove the variance. Nonetheless, the reported results underscore the company’s ability to outperform in a competitive generics landscape.

However, based on the first‑quarter performance, management may express confidence in maintaining momentum through the remainder of 2026. The company’s strategy likely centers on expanding its generic drug portfolio, advancing its branded pipeline (including the rare disease asset Cortrophin® Gel), and pursuing value‑accretive business development. Key growth catalysts could include label expansions, new product launches, and additional regulatory approvals. On the other hand, risk factors remain: the generic drug market continues to face pricing pressure, supply chain disruptions may affect raw material availability, and the timing of FDA approvals is inherently uncertain. ANI also carries a meaningful debt load following prior acquisitions, which could strain free cash flow if interest rates remain elevated. The recent stock decline, despite the robust EPS beat, may reflect market concerns about revenue visibility or broader sector rotation. The company may need to demonstrate that the first quarter’s EPS performance is repeatable and not reliant on non‑recurring items. Investors will closely watch the upcoming earnings call for any color on guidance, capital allocation priorities, and pacing of new product launches.

The market’s muted reaction to ANI’s massive EPS beat—a 0.27% stock decline—suggests that the earnings surprise alone may not be enough to sustain upward momentum without accompanying revenue growth or updated guidance. Some investors might have taken profits after a strong run‑up leading into the report, while others could be waiting for more granular segment data. Analyst sentiment may shift positively; several firms may raise their EPS estimates for the full year, though price target adjustments could be tempered by the lack of revenue disclosure. The high earnings quality implied by the beat could, however, attract value‑oriented and fundamentals‑focused investors. Key watch items going forward include: the company’s ability to convert earnings strength into sustained topline expansion, margin trajectory in upcoming quarters, and progress on key pipeline milestones. The stock’s current valuation may still offer an attractive entry point if the EPS beat proves durable. Caution is warranted given the opaque revenue picture, but the quarter undeniably highlights ANI’s operational resilience. Continued execution against its strategic priorities may help the stock regain investor confidence.
